Output 8d0295aea35294ac321059f7e5e3f431fc0767e2ea70f3c43629b62ff4f38b52:25

value
377637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 998768b00ec51989674aabbf5489229d58481eeb OP_EQUAL
address
3FgoXGi61ertNK8ARMftUQbWEoATsEHr8V
transaction
8d0295aea35294ac321059f7e5e3f431fc0767e2ea70f3c43629b62ff4f38b52
spent
true